OBJECTIVE@#To explore risk factors for infections after arthroscopic rotator cuff repair, and improve the under standing for reducing infection.@*METHODS@#Clinical data of 2 591 patients who underwent arthroscopic rotator cuff repair from January 2019 to January 2022 were retrospectively analyzed, including 1 265 males and 1 326 females, aged from 25 to 82 years old with an average age of (51.5±15.6) years old. They were divided into infection group(n=18) and uninfected group(n=2 573) according to whether or not patients had postoperative infection. Gender, age, smoking, diabetes, body mass index, local closure within 1 month before operation, operation time, preventive use of antibiotics, and internal fixation implantation between two groups were recorded. Univariate Logistic regression analysis screened factors associated with infections after arthroscopic rotator cuff repair. Theresultswere entered into the multivariate logistic regression analysis, screening the high risk factors for infections after arthroscopic rotator cuff repair.@*RESULTS@#In 2 591 patients, 18 patients were infected after operation, infection rate was 0.69%. Univariate Logistic regression analysis showed that gender, age, operation time, antibiotic prophylaxis, internal fixation implantation were risk factors for infections after arthroscopic rotator cuff repair. Multivariate Logistic regression analysis showed male(OR=14.227), age≥65 years(OR=34.313), operation time≥2 h (OR=15.616), without antibiotic prophylaxis(OR=4.891), and internal fixation implantation(OR=5.103) were major risk factors for infection after arthroscopic rotator cuff repair(P<0.05).@*CONCLUSION@#Male, age≥65 years, operation time≥2 h, without antibiotic prophylaxis and internal fixation implantation were independent risk factors for infection after arthroscopic rotator cuff repair. Early diagnosis and timely treatment should be carried out to reduce the incidence of infection.

OBJECTIVE@#To investigate the incidence and related risk factors of healthy side fracture after hip fracture surgery in the elderly, so as to provide basis for the prevention of re-fracture.@*METHODS@#The data of 452 patients over 65 years old with femoral neck fracture or intertrochanteric fracture treated with hip arthroplasty or proximal femoral intramedullary nailing from June 2012 to June 2017 were analyzed, including 168 males and 284 females, the age ranged from 65 to 97(75.5±7.5) years. There were 191 cases of femoral neck fracture and 261 cases of femoral intertrochanteric fracture. According to whether there was a fracture in the healthy hip after operation, the patients were divided into fracture group and no fracture group. The gender, age, body mass index, fracture type, initial treatment method, bone mineral density, bed time, medical compliance, postoperative short-term delirium, whether there were medical diseases before injury and Harris score of hip joint in the final follow-up were recorded. Univariate Logistic regression analysis was used to screen out the risk factors of healthy side fracture after operation, and then statistically significant risk factors were included in multi factor Logistic regression analysis to screen out the independent risk factors of healthy side fracture after operation of hip fracture in the elderly.@*RESULTS@#Among them, 42 of the 452 patients had hip fractures on the healthy side with an incidence of 9.3%. The average interval between the two fractures was (2.9±2.1) years. Univariate Logistic regression analysis showed that there were significant differences in age, bone mineral density, medical compliance, short-term postoperative deliriun, pre-injury complicated with medical diseases and Harris score of hip joint in the final follow-up (P<0.05). Multivariate Logistic analysis showed that age(OR=4.227), bone mineral density(OR=4.313), combined with medical diseases (OR=5.616) and low hip Harris score at the final follow-up (OR=3.891) were independent risk factors for healthy side fractures after hip fracture surgery in elderly(P<0.05).@*CONCLUSION@#The age, bone mineral density, combined with medical diseases and low Harris score of hip joint in the final follow-up are the main risk factors of healthy side fracture after hip fracture in the elderly. It is necessary to strengthen the treatment of medical diseases, anti osteoporosis and improve hip joint function within 3 years after operation, so as to prevent the occurrence of healthy side hip fracture.

Diabetic foot ulcers (DFUs) is a severe complication of the diabetes mellitus, which is the first leading cause of non-traumatic lower limbs amputations. The pathogenesis of diabetic foot involves a variety of mechanisms, treatment involves the department of foot and ankle surgery, department of vascular surgery, endocrinology, and infection control. Treatment need multidisciplinary diagnosis and treatment. Debridement is the basis of treating diabetic foot ulcers, and the normal anatomical structure should be maintained during the process. Vacuum sealing drainage (VSD) and antibiotic-laden bone cement (ALBC) have more advantages of controlling infection and ulceration wound healing, which could receive good clinical effect. Tendon lengthening could alleviate the problem of ulcer occurrence and progression caused by stress concentration on the bottom of foot, which has widely application and has advantages of preventing formation of foot ulcers. Flap transplantation could solve the problem of wound healing, but it is necessary to consider whether the transplanted flap could bear the same function as plantar tissue. Tibial bone transverse distraction is a relatively new technique, and the mechanism is not clear, but it has certain application prospects from the perspective of clinical efficacy.

<p><b>OBJECTIVE</b>To explore clinical application of three-dimensional printing technology to design individual angle section on Chevron of hallux valgus osteotomy.</p><p><b>METHODS</b>From May 2013 to May 2016, 47 patients(66 feet) with mild to moderate hallux valgus treated by Chevron osteotomy according to different preoperative design were divided into computer osteotomy group(group A) and traditional osteotomy group(group B). In group A, there were 25 patients (33 feet), including 4 males(5 feet) and 21 females(28 feet) with an average age of (47.88±6.08) years old, average weight IMA was (13.58±1.15) degree, AOFAS score was 59.00±5.86, and treated individual 3D printing technology to design operation scheme. While in group B, there were 22 patients (33 feet), including 3 males (3 feet) and 19 females (28 feet) with an average age of (48.16±6.16) years old, average weight IMA was(13.51±1.14) degree, AOFAS score was 60.67±5.85, and treated with osteotomy according to surgical experience. Operation time, blood loss, hospital stays, VAS score at 1 week after operation, wound healing and improvement of postoperative weight-bearing intermetatarsal angle(IMA) were compared between two groups, AOFAS score system was used to evaluate ankle function after surgery.</p><p><b>RESULTS</b>There was no significant difference in following-up between group A 12.41±2.32 and group B 11.73±2.76. There was 1 patient in group B were excluded. Others perform good wounds healing on the first stage after operation. There were no significant differences in operation time, blood loss, hospital stays and VAS score at 1 week after operation(<0.05); IMA in group A was (5.21±0.88)°, (6.42±0.85)° in group B, and had significant differences between two groups (=5.68, <0.05). There was obvious meaning in AOFAS score between group A 88.15±5.19 and group B 82.90±5.01(=4.14, <0.05). Fourteen feet in group A obtained excellent results and 19 feet good, while 5 feet in group B obtained excellent results and 27 feet good.</p><p><b>CONCLUSIONS</b>Compared with traditional osteotomy group, three-dimensional printing technology to design individual angle section on Chevron of hallux valgus osteotomy could better correct IMA, improve postoperative foot function, and it is a kind of individualized and digital method to design operation.</p>

<p><b>OBJECTIVE</b>To discusses the clinical effects of arthroscopy combined with minimally invasive percutaneous plate osteosynthesis(MIPPO) technology in treating Schatzker IV tibial plateau fractures.</p><p><b>METHODS</b>From January 2012 to January 2016, 19 patients with Schatzker type IV tibial plateau fractures were treated with arthroscopy combined with minimally invasive technique including 12 males and 7 females with an average age of 46.5 years old ranging from 19 to 78 years old. Patients were suffering knee pain, swelling, flexion and extension limited, and other symptoms preoperative. Patients were followed up and assessed by Rasmussen knee function score.</p><p><b>RESULTS</b>No infection, traumatic arthritis, and knee joint valgus occurred after operation. Nineteen cases were followed up for 12 to 24 months with an average of 18.6 months. Fracture healing time was 3 to 5 months with an average of 3.8 months. The knee pain and limited mobility improved significantly. The range of autonomic movement of joints was from 90 to 136 degrees. According to Rasmussen functional score criteria, the total score was 27.00±2.49, the result was excellent in 16 cases, good in 2 cases, fair in 1 case.</p><p><b>CONCLUSIONS</b>Arthroscopic treatment for Schatzker type IV tibial plateau fractures combined with MIPPO can simultaneously treat internal structural injuries such as meniscus and other knee joints, with less trauma, fewer complications, and faster joint function recovery, but we must strictly grasp surgical indications and avoid expanding injuries.</p>

<p><b>OBJECTIVE</b>To study operative effects for the treatment of multiple ligament injuries of knee joints.</p><p><b>METHODS</b>From 2008 to 2013, 26 patients (17 males and 9 females) with multiple ligament injuries of knee joints were treated surgically. The average age was 40.7 years old, ranging from 29 to 55 years old. All the patients were treated with arthroscopic reconstruction of cruiate ligament with autogenous or allogeneic hamstrings and tendon, and at the same time received repair of medial collateral ligament and lateral collateral ligament, as well as the treatment of exterior and interior complex injuries. Nine patients received second stage operation after the initial operation for mistake or missed diagnosis, and other patients were treated at the first stage. The Lysholm scoring system was used to evaluate function and stability of knee joints before and after operation.</p><p><b>RESULTS</b>All the patients were followed up for an average duration of 1.6 years (ranged, 0.8 to 3.2 years). The mean awaiting time for operation was 1.2 months. The Lysholm score was improved from preoperative 42.5 +/- 4.5 (ranged, 33 to 48) to the latest follow-up 78.1 +/- 3.9 (ranged, 57 to 95). The function of knee joint was improved obviously in the arthroscopic reconstruction patients, with joint range of motion exceeding 900 and with Varus & Valgus tests near to normal. All the patients had negative findings in the Lachman test at 70 degrees of flexion.</p><p><b>CONCLUSION</b>Arthroscopic reconstruction should be the first choice in treating multiple ligament injuries of knee joints. If the anterior and posterior cruciate ligament injuries can't be treated simultaneously, the posterior cruciate ligament injuries should be treated preferentially at the first stage and the anterior cruciate ligament injuries should be treated at the second stage. The diagnosis of posterior cruciate ligament is easy to be missed.</p>

<p><b>OBJECTIVE</b>To evaluate the feasibility and efficacy of unilateral pedicle screw fixation in treating thoracolumbar fractures through paraspinal approach.</p><p><b>METHODS</b>From January 2006 to January 2009,21 patients with single level thoracolumbar fracture without neurological symptoms were treated with unilateral pedicle screw fixation through paraspinal approach. There were 14 males and 7 females,aged from 21 to 65 years old with a mean of 36.4 years. The duration from injury to operation ranged from 6 h to 5 d with an average of 3 d. According to the classification of Denis fracture, compression fractures happedned in 12 cases and burst fractures happened in 9 cases,including 1 case with T5 fracture, 2 cases with T7 fracture, 2 cases with T10 fracture, 3 cases with T11 fracture, 8 cases with T12 fracture, and 5 cases with L1 fracture. Based on the Flankel grade, all patients were classified as grade E. Anterior vertebral body height ratio, sagittal Cobb angle, condition of internal fixation failure, visual analogue score (VAS) were evaluated.</p><p><b>RESULTS</b>All patients were followed up from 12 to 36 months with an average of 20.5 months. No internal fixation failure was found. Anterior vertebral body height ratios at preoperative 3 days after operation and last follow-up were 54.3 +/- 2.8, 92.9 +/- 1.5, 93.8 +/- 1.7, respectively;sagittal Cobb angle at the three timepoints were (27.8 +/- 2.5) degrees, (5.3 +/- 0.8) degrees, (6.3 +/- 1.4) degrees, respectively; the difference was statistical significant (P < 0.05). VAS was (1.2 +/- 0.4) points at last follow-up and had obviously improved (P < 0.05).</p><p><b>CONCLUSION</b>Treatment of thoracolumbar fractures with unilateral pedicle screw fixation through paraspinal approach is safe with the advantages of micro-trauma and less blood loss,which can not only completely retain the posterior spinal complex structure, reinforce the spinal stability, raise the reductional quality, but also improve the strength of fixation and the distribution of stress force.</p>

Finite element analysis (FEA) is broadly used in engineering, it was initially applied to simulate and solve a variety of engineering mechanics, thermal, electromagnetics, and other physical problems. The principle is a collective to be composed by an infinite number of particles, and an unlimited number of degrees of freedom from the continuum approximation. Brekelmas and Ryblcki firstly applied the finite element method to orthopedic biomechanics research in 1972. The first cervical vertebra finite element model was established in 1982 by Hosey. With the computer and software technology advances in the past 20 years, finite element method in cervical spine biomechanics studies is increased and widespread.

<p><b>OBJECTIVE</b>To investigate the damage characteristics and biomechanical mechanisms of the thoracolumbar vertebral bursh fracture during the impact loading.</p><p><b>METHODS</b>From September 2008 to October 2009, 10 fresh human thoracolumbar spine specimens were collected for experimental model and divided into two groups. Biomechanical static and dynamic impact strength test were performed respectively in two groups. The static and dynamic data from thoracolumbar vertebrae shock response in different loads were observated.</p><p><b>RESULTS</b>Thoracolumbar yield load was (5 280.00 +/- 354.2) N, yield displacement was (13.32 +/- 2.07) mm, the limit load was(6 590.00 +/- 249.20) N, ultimate displacement was (20.60 +/- 2.57) mm, load speed was 0.02 g, and the average limit load of dynamic mechanical properties of thoracic and lumbar vertebrae was (14 425.60 +/- 1101.52) N, the average reaction time load was (17.29 +/- 2.04) ms, the average of acceleration was (36.80 +/- 2.81) g, the dynamic displacement was (45.11 +/- 1.13) mm.</p><p><b>CONCLUSION</b>Thoracolumbar vertebral burst fracture is a serious injury caused by the release of high-energy moment, the role of biomechanical forces are in a pattern of pulse change, thoracic and lumbar vertebrae present with the viscoelastic properties of biological materials.</p>
